Explore the fundamentals of quantum computing hardware in this 37-minute lecture from the HackadayU Quantum Computing series, led by Dr. Kitty Yeung. Delve into key concepts including the Stern-Gerlach experiment, quantum dots, trapped ions, dilution refrigerators, and topological quantum computers. Gain a comprehensive understanding of the physical systems and technologies that underpin quantum computing, from experimental foundations to cutting-edge implementations.
